Typical low-high price ranges for commercial air duct cleaning vary based on project scope and building size. Generally, costs can fall within a certain range depending on the complexity and extent of the cleaning needed.
$300 - $1,200 for small commercial spaces or basic cleaning services.
$2,000 - $6,000 for larger commercial buildings or more thorough cleaning projects.
| Project Type | Typical Range |
|---|---|
| Small Office or Retail Space | $300 - $700 |
| Large Office Building | $1,500 - $4,000 |
| Industrial Facility | $4,000 - $10,000 |
| Restaurant or Commercial Kitchen | $1,000 - $3,500 |
| Hospital or Medical Facility | $3,000 - $6,000 |
| School or Educational Institution | $2,000 - $5,000 |
What affects the cost
Several factors can influence the overall expense of commercial air duct cleaning projects. Understanding these elements can help in comparing options and estimating potential costs.
- Materials and duct type: Different materials and duct designs may require specialized cleaning methods or equipment, impacting costs.
- Size and scope of the system: Larger or more complex duct systems typically require more time and resources, affecting pricing.
- Labor complexity: Systems with difficult access points or intricate layouts can increase labor requirements and costs.
- Permitting and regulations: Certain projects may necessitate permits or adherence to specific standards, influencing overall expenses.
- Additional services or extras: Services such as sanitizing, deodorizing, or inspecting components can add to the total cost.
